#d3e6f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3e6f2 is composed of 82.7% red, 90.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.8%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 88.8%. #d3e6f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a7cde5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

● #d3e6f2 color description : Light grayish blue.
#d3e6f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3e6f2 has RGB values of R:211, G:230,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13887218.

Shades and Tints of #d3e6f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3e6f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e2e3e3 is the less saturated color, while #c8e8fd is the most saturated one.
